A DUTCH DELFT BLUE AND WHITE RECTANGULAR TEA CANISTER AND COVER, CIRCA 1690-1700

painted in Chinese 'Transitional' style with birds on rockwork, the sides with flower cartouches on a foliate-scrollwork ground, outlined in black, with screw-top cover, AK monogram mark over numeral 4 in manganese for Adrianus Kocx, De Grieksche A (The Greek A) factory, 1687-1701.
height 4⅞ in.
12.4 cm

Condition Report:
The screw molded section of caddy with some typical minor losses and glaze flaking
The cover a good fit, with a restored chip to edge. Overall good appearance.
